Newly elected Senator Joni Ernst (R-Iowa), part of Gov. Palin’s Bench but got Mitt Romney’s endorsement as well, will deliver the GOP response to President Barack Obama's 2015 State of the Union address on Tuesday January 20th, Senate Majority Leader Mitch McConnell (R-Ky.) announced at the House and Senate GOP retreat in Hershey, Pennsylvania.

 Congrats Joni from Sarah

"Sen. Ernst brings a unique perspective to the Senate. She is a mother, a soldier and an independent leader who serves in Washington because Americans voted for change in the last election, and Joni understands that middle-class Americans want Congress to get back to work and that they want Washington to get refocused on their concerns, instead of those of the political class,” said McConnell in a statement on Thursday.

Ernst who was elected to the Senate in November, becoming the first woman elected to federal office from Iowa and promised to make Washington squeal if she was elected, said she is "truly honored" to deliver the GOP address.

House Speaker John Boehner praised Ernst after the announcement Thursday.

"She knows that our federal government is too big, our spending is too high, and our tax code is broken," Boehner said. “And, she knows first-hand the sacrifices our men and women in uniform make to keep us all safe in a dangerous world," he added.

Republicans who have previously given the GOP response to the State of the Union address include Senator. Marco Rubio (Fla.) and Rep. Cathy McMorris Rodgers (Wash.) and Gov. Bobby Jindal (LA), to name just a few.
